Ultrasound Imaging: A Cornerstone of Ob Gyn Tech

Ultrasound imaging is one of the most widely used technologies in obstetrics and gynecology. It provides real-time images of the fetus and reproductive organs, aiding in the diagnosis and monitoring of various conditions. Modern ultrasound machines offer high-resolution images, making it easier for healthcare providers to detect abnormalities early.

Key benefits of ultrasound imaging include:

  • Non-invasive and safe for both mother and fetus
  • Provides detailed images of the fetus and reproductive organs
  • Useful for monitoring fetal development and detecting potential issues

Advancements in ultrasound technology, such as 3D and 4D imaging, have further enhanced its capabilities. These technologies allow for more detailed and dynamic views of the fetus, providing valuable information for prenatal care.

Robotic Surgery: Precision and Minimally Invasive Procedures

Robotic surgery has emerged as a game-changer in Ob Gyn Tech. Systems like the da Vinci Surgical System enable surgeons to perform complex procedures with unprecedented precision and control. This technology allows for minimally invasive surgeries, reducing recovery time and minimizing the risk of complications.

Some of the key advantages of robotic surgery include:

  • Enhanced precision and control
  • Reduced recovery time
  • Minimally invasive procedures
  • Improved patient outcomes

Robotic surgery is particularly beneficial for procedures such as hysterectomies, myomectomies, and endometriosis treatments. The technology's ability to provide a magnified, 3D view of the surgical site allows surgeons to perform intricate procedures with greater accuracy.

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ning in Ob Gyn Tech

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) are transforming Ob Gyn Tech by providing advanced diagnostic tools and predictive analytics. AI algorithms can analyze vast amounts of medical data to identify patterns and predict outcomes, aiding in early detection and treatment of various conditions.

Applications of AI and ML in obstetrics and gynecology include:

  • Early detection of fetal abnormalities
  • Predictive analytics for pregnancy complications
  • Personalized treatment plans
  • Improved diagnostic accuracy

For example, AI-powered imaging systems can analyze ultrasound images to detect fetal anomalies that might be missed by human eyes. Similarly, ML algorithms can predict the risk of complications such as preeclampsia or gestational diabetes, allowing for proactive management and intervention.

Innovations in Contraceptive Technology

Contraceptive technology has seen significant advancements, offering women more options for family planning. From hormonal contraceptives to long-acting reversible contraceptives (LARCs), the range of choices has expanded, providing greater flexibility and convenience. These innovations have improved the effectiveness and safety of contraceptive methods, empowering women to take control of their reproductive health.

Some of the latest innovations in contraceptive technology include:

  • Hormonal contraceptives with improved formulations
  • Long-acting reversible contraceptives (LARCs) such as IUDs and implants
  • Non-hormonal contraceptive options
  • Emergency contraception with enhanced effectiveness

LARCs, in particular, have gained popularity due to their high effectiveness and convenience. These methods provide long-term contraception without the need for daily or monthly administration, reducing the risk of user error and improving overall reliability.
